Recall history
2 distinct campaigns affect this selection. Announcement dates below are different from vehicle model years. A campaign may cover multiple years.
00V131003 · Power Train:Automatic Transmission
Reported: 2000-05-30 (May 30, 2000)
VEHICLE DESCRIPTION: HEAVY DUTY TRUCKS EQUIPPED WITH EATON AUTOSHIFT GEN II TRANSMISSION ASSEMBLIES. DUE TO A SOFTWARE PROBLEM IN THE TRANSMISSION ASSEMBLIES, THE TRANSMISSION WILL SELECT THE WRONG GEAR.
Consequence: IF AN INAPPROPRIATE GEAR IS SELECTED WITHOUT THE DRIVER'S KNOWLEDGE, THE VEHICLE WILL REACT DIFFERENTLY THAN EXPECTED, POSSIBLY RESULTING IN INJURY OR CRASH.
Remedy: EATON IS CONDUCTING THE OWNER NOTIFICATION AND REMEDY FOR THIS RECALL. DEALERS WILL REPLACE THE AUTOSHIFT TRANSMISSIONS.

Reported: 2002-04-11 (April 11, 2002)
CERTAIN HEAVY DUTY CLASS 8 VEHICLES FAIL TO COMPLY WITH FEDERAL MOTOR VEHICLE SAFETY STANDARD NO. 121, "AIR BRAKE SYSTEMS", S5.1.6.3, "ANTILOCK POWER FOR TOWED VEHICLES." ELECTRICAL POWER FOR THE TRAILER ANTI-LOCK BRAKING SYSTEM (ABS) CAN BE DISRUPTED WHEN A SWITCH LOCATED ON THE VEHICLE INSTRUMENT PANEL IS ACTIVATED TO CONTROL LIGHTING WITHIN THE TRAILER.
Consequence: IF THIS CONDITION OCCURS, THE DRIVER CAN LOSE OF THE TOWED VEHICLE, POSSIBLY RESULTING IN A VEHICLE CRASH.
Remedy: DEALERS WILL INSTALL A WIRING HARNESS WHICH WILL PROVIDE CONTINUOUS ELECTRICAL POWER TO THE TRAILER ABS WHENEVER THE IGNITION SWITCH IS IN THE ON OR RUN POSITION. OWNER NOTIFICATION BEGAN APRIL 29, 2002.
